A 2026 study by Pia Fehrenbach compares immune cell profiles in 17 patients with surgical site infections after spine surgery against 20 matched control patients without infections. Peripheral blood mononuclear cells were analyzed using high-dimensional mass cytometry, identifying 46 immune cell clusters. The research reveals significant differences in 30 clusters, including decreased natural killer cells and increased activated T-cell subsets in infected patients.
